DEPARTMENT OF COMPUTING

CS 1410 | Syllabus | Assignments | [print]

CS 1410: Object-oriented Programming

Fall 2022 Schedule

This schedule is subject to change. Class announcements may modify the schedule from that listed below.

Day Topic Assignment due on Tuesday Drills due Wednesday Quiz/Exam on Thursday/Friday
W1 Jan 6-10 Review, Dictionaries No Assignment Due Week 01 Python Quick Review Quiz 1
W2 Jan 13-17 Introduction to Classes DNA Sequencing Week 02 Dictionary Drills Quiz 2
H Jan 20 MLK Jr. Day (no classes)
W3 Jan 21-24 Instances, Data members ISBN Index Week 03 Class Drills Quiz 3
W4 Jan 27-31 Methods, Constructors Gas Mileage Week 04 Make Class Drills Quiz 4
W5 Feb 3-7 Containment Caloric Balance Week 05 More Class Drills Quiz 5
W6 Feb 10-14 Aggregation Word Zap! Week 06 Review Drills (2 sets) Quiz 6
H Feb 17 President’s Day (no classes)
W7 Feb 18-21 Review No Assignment Due No Drills Due Midterm
W8 Feb 24-28 Modules Illustrate No Drills Due
W9 Mar 2-6 Inheritance Pong Part 1 Week 09 Inheritance Drills Quiz 9
W10 Mar 9-13 Polymorphism Pong Part 2 Week 10 Polymorphism Drills Quiz 10
H Mar 16-20 Spring Break (no classes)
W11 Mar 23-27 Operator overloading Frogger Part 1 Week 11 Operator Overload Drills Quiz 11
W12 Mar 30-Apr 3 Exceptions Frogger Part 2 No Drills Due Quiz 12
W13 Apr 6-10 Object Oriented Development Asteroids Part 1 Week 13 Two Review Drills Quiz 13
W14 Apr 13-17 Object Oriented Development Asteroids Part 2 Week 14 Two Review Drills Quiz 14
W15 Apr 20-22 Review
H Apr 23 Reading Day (no classes)
F Section 1 Final Exam Mon, Apr 27 9-10:50am
F Section 2 Final Exam Wed, Apr 29 9-10:50am
F Section 3 Final Exam Thu, Apr 30 1-2:50pm

Drill Instructions

Last Updated 08/24/2022